Atlantic Center
Atlantic Center is a shopping center in Brooklyn, New York which is located on Atlantic Avenue. Atlantic Center is situated nearby to Museum of Contemporary African Diasporan Arts, as well as near Hanson Place Seventh-day Adventist Church.Places of Interest Nearby

Hanson Place Seventh-day Adventist Church
Church
Photo: Beyond My Ken,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Hanson Place Seventh-day Adventist Church, is an historic church at 88 Hanson Place between South Oxford Street and South Portland Avenue in the Fort Greene neighborhood of Brooklyn, New York City, which was built in 1857-60 as the Hanson Place Baptist Church. Hanson Place Seventh-day Adventist Church is situated 450 feet northeast of Atlantic Center.

Fort Greene
Neighborhood
Photo: Beyond My Ken,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Fort Greene is a neighborhood in the northwestern part of the New York City borough of Brooklyn. The neighborhood is bounded by Flushing Avenue and the Brooklyn Navy Yard to the north, Flatbush Avenue Extension and Downtown Brooklyn to the west, Atlantic Avenue and Prospect Heights to the south, and Vanderbilt Avenue and Clinton Hill to the east.
Clinton Hill Historic District
Locality
Photo: Jim.henderson, CC0.
Clinton Hill Historic District is a national historic district in Clinton Hill, Brooklyn, in New York City. It consists of 1,063 largely residential contributing buildings built between the 1840s and 1930 in popular contemporary and revival styles.
